Kingdom To Stream In Netflix From This Date

Kingdom OTT Streaming Details

Vijay Deverakonda's action-packed spy thriller "Kingdom" has opened big in theaters and is now gearing up for its digital debut on Netflix. Directed by Gautam Tinnanuri, the film was released on July 31, 2025, and despite receiving mixed reviews, it had a decent opening at the box office, collecting under Rs 45 crore in its first week. However, the film's momentum didn't last long, and it's expected to hit Netflix soon.

The OTT rights for "Kingdom" were acquired by Netflix for a whopping Rs 50 crore, covering all languages with a 4-week theatrical window. According to reports, the film might premiere on Netflix around August 28 or September 1, 2025. Fans are eagerly awaiting the OTT release, hoping that the makers will include an extended cut with deleted scenes, such as a romantic song and a fight sequence, which were omitted from the theatrical version.

"Kingdom" is an Anirudh Ravichander musical that follows the story of Surya "Suri," a humble police constable played by Vijay Deverakonda, who gets recruited for an undercover operation. The film also stars Sathyadev, Bhagyashri Borse, and others, and its plot explores themes of loyalty, betrayal, and brotherhood. Despite its promising premise, the film's box office performance has been underwhelming, with a budget of Rs 130 crore, making it uncertain whether it will break even.

The film's controversy surrounding the depiction of Sri Lankan Tamils has sparked protests, and the team has issued an apology. With "Kingdom" set to stream on Netflix soon, fans are curious to see how the film plays out in its digital version and whether the extended cut will add value to the storytelling.
